BTEC L3 Unit 1 – Communication and Employability Skills for IT

Recap Last time: – Introduction to the unit – Look at personality types and the way that they are used to profile types of jobs and applicants – Talked about personal attributes and skills – Watched two videos and captured some headings on personal attributes and skills This session we are looking at personal development and personal development plans

Personal Development Personal: – Applies just to you Development: – Over a period of time Establishing a benchmark Building on your strengths Managing you weaknesses

What you will have for this Unit AS1 Setting a benchmark AS2 Strengths and Weaknesses AS3 My USP AS4 Technical skills AS5 Planning AS6 Attributes and attitudes AS7 Personal Development Plan

Assignment 3 Personal Development This assignment covers the following: – Personal evaluation and creation of an initial PDP, P7 – Tracking aims and objectives and providing evidence of progress and reflection, P8 – Understanding how you learn and the different ways of learning, M3 – Reflection on the overall progress that you have made towards you personal goals, D2

General Attributes, Skills AS1 Planning Organisational Time Management Team Working Verbal Written Numeracy Creativity Have you too much or too little of these?: Take each heading and: create a short definition about that the general attribute is write one paragraph about how good you are at this attribute do you know anyone that is particularly good at it? state how you think this attribute would matter to an employer Create a Word Template Referencing – One Note

Attitudes AS1 Determination Independence Integrity Tolerance Dependability Problem Solving Leadership Confidence Self-motivation Have you too much or too little of these?: Take each heading and: create a short definition about that the general attribute is write one paragraph about how good you are at this attribute do you know anyone that is particularly good at it? state how you think this attribute would matter to an employer Create a Word Template Referencing – One Note

Technical Skills AS4 Research some jobs in the IT Industry Look for: – Skills required – Attributes preferred Keep Potential job sites: – Jobs.co.uk

Personal Blogs A bit like a diary or personal journal Want you to get used to writing a short blog for each unit that you are doing, but certainly for Unit1 For this session, I would like you to write a blog entry of 200 words on one or two of the opportunities that you arrived at and how you plan to achieve them

Summary Introduced and revised information to help you complete and track your Personal Development Plan You MUST provide evidence that you have completed and tracked your PDP as part of Assignment 3 Tomorrows session will introduce assignment 3
